**LiftSim Dispatch Model — Scoring Weights**

LiftSim assigns hall calls by scoring each car on projected wait time, energy cost, and load balance. Reviewers should verify that weight changes preserve the invariant that wait time dominates under peak traffic, since the Ardwick tower scenario depends on it. Weights are normalized at load and validated in tests. The weights under review are.

constants for kageg-bawif:
QUOTAS = {
    "quenwyn": 1,
    "oliix": 10,
}

Subject: Quickstore 4.2 — bloom filter now fronts the KV layer

Plugin authors: starting with this release, Quickstore places a bloom filter ahead of the key-value store. Negative lookups return faster; false positives fall through safely. No API changes are required on your side. Verify your plugin against the staging build referenced below.

session token of fahif-tadup = htk3_9c7

Internal Memo — Survey Instrument Crate

Heads-up for the evening shift: the crate of Tarnwell survey instruments (theodolites and two laser levels) is due out tomorrow morning for the Redmarsh site. It's the green crate near bay three — don't stack anything on it, the optics are touchy. Strap it last onto the van so it comes off first. The confidential courier hand-over instruction is given right below this note.

dispatch memo: the sorox briiel courier leaves the druius kelion fenir gorvan ralael rusius julwyn belwyn ledger at gate 4220 under passcode 637242